Guidewire PolicyCenter
enterpriseCore insurance suite including policy administration, billing, and claims management.
Endorsement and cancellation processing uses coverage-aware rules that emit consistent policy events for downstream systems.
Guidewire PolicyCenter is built for insurers that need policy and coverage administration with strong control over changes and event chronology. It supports endorsement and renewal processing with configurable business rules that can route work to teams using work queues. Integration depth is strongest when underwriting, billing, and claims systems use the same policy event model, reducing reconciliation overhead. Enterprise governance is handled through RBAC, audit trails on policy changes, and controlled configuration workflows.
A key tradeoff is that major workflow customizations often require configuration discipline and a Guidewire release-aligned change process. PolicyCenter fits best when insurers already have Guidewire components in place or when they can match policy event semantics across core and downstream systems. Teams should plan for integration testing around endorsement sequences, retroactive changes, and cancellation timing because those edge cases affect downstream billing and risk reporting.

Riskonnect
enterpriseCloud-based risk management information system for enterprise risk, claims, and safety.
Configurable workflow orchestration that links incident intake, safety tasks, and underwriting-relevant follow-up under governance controls.
Riskonnect fits insurers and risk-focused enterprises that need end-to-end incident workflows tied to underwriting risk assessment and downstream handling. The workflow engine supports configurable states, role-based task assignment, and audit-friendly history for operational activities that start at inspection or incident intake. Integration depth is a major consideration because teams typically use the API to sync exposure, claim, and policy context rather than rekeying data. A documented RBAC model supports governance for different user groups across risk, underwriting, and operations teams.
A key tradeoff is that workflow configuration requires governance discipline to keep states, field requirements, and automation rules consistent across business units. Riskonnect works best when a central team standardizes workflow templates and data mappings, then regional teams adopt them for consistent incident reporting and loss control execution.

SAS Risk Modeling
enterpriseEnterprise risk modeling and stress testing for insurance and banking.
Model publishing and repeatable execution of scoring pipelines built around SAS modeling artifacts.
SAS Risk Modeling supports end-to-end modeling workflows such as data preparation for risk variables, model building, and testing outputs that can be reused in downstream risk assessment runs. The product integrates into analytics and data environments that already use SAS, which reduces friction when risk teams rely on existing SAS code and model artifacts. Automation and extensibility are centered on running modeling pipelines in repeatable ways, with configuration controls that help keep model runs consistent across environments.
A key tradeoff is that the system is less positioned for claims or certificate administration workflows that typical RMIS products implement as data entry and document operations. SAS Risk Modeling fits best when a team needs actuarial risk analysis and underwriting risk assessment outputs packaged for repeat runs, such as monthly exposure remeasurement or scenario-based catastrophe risk scoring. Teams that require heavy workflow UI for loss control or incident reporting may find they need complementary tooling outside the modeling layer.

Moody's RMS
enterpriseCatastrophe risk management and modeling software for insurance.
Scenario-driven catastrophe modeling workflow that converts hazard and exposure assumptions into decision-ready risk outputs.
Moody's RMS brings insurance catastrophe and risk quantification workflows into an insurance risk management software environment. It is distinct for turning hazard and exposure inputs into modeling outputs that can drive underwriting risk assessment and enterprise exposure monitoring.
Moody's RMS also supports integration patterns that let risk teams feed results into adjacent planning and reporting processes without manual spreadsheet handoffs. The fit is strongest when catastrophe modeling outputs and exposure coverage are central to day-to-day risk decisions.

Pitfalls that derail insurance risk management projects and how to avoid them
Insurance risk management tools often fail when implementation choices ignore workflow ownership and audit traceability requirements. Many tools also require disciplined configuration to keep mappings consistent across systems.
Avoiding these pitfalls depends on picking the right product model for the workflow loop and capacity available for governance and configuration.
Treating policy event integration as a generic workflow mapping task
Guidewire PolicyCenter depends on consistent policy event models and coverage-aware endorsement or cancellation rules, so end-to-end policy event integrations need extensive testing for edge-case timing. Teams that under-specify event integration testing often struggle to keep downstream billing and claims alignment correct in the presence of complex policy changes.
Overloading a governance-first platform without planning for configuration and taxonomy ownership
IBM OpenPages requires disciplined taxonomy ownership and permissions design for governed oversight across multiple risk programs. RSA Archer also requires significant workflow and form configuration effort for approval and evidence traceability, so governance teams must staff configuration work rather than expecting minimal admin overhead.
Using a model-centric tool for operational claims or certificate workflows
SAS Risk Modeling is optimized for model artifact workflows and repeatable scoring runs, so it is less suited for claims document workflows and certificate operations. Organizations that need certificate and incident operations often see better fit with policy-centric platforms like Duck Creek Policy or workflow-centric platforms like Riskonnect and Sapiens Insurance.
Expecting incident workflow automation to work without strong internal ownership of mappings
Riskonnect can reduce manual triage through configurable states and role-based routing, but workflow configuration needs strong internal ownership and change control. When mappings span multiple systems, complex projects take longer to validate because incident, hazard, and underwriting-relevant follow-up definitions must stay consistent.
Applying graph-first entity resolution without specialist data governance for advanced configuration
Quantexa provides graph entity resolution and audit-traceable connections, but advanced configuration requires specialist data governance discipline. Teams that do not invest in data governance and mapping quality risk inconsistent entity linking that weakens risk scoring and investigation workflow outputs.
